Also for anyone who does not remember, here’s the list of seasons in order from first to latest and when exactly they happened:
Gratitude (July-August 2019)
Lightseekers (September-October 2019)
Belonging (November-December 2019)
Rhythm (January-March 2020)
Enchantment (April-June 2020)
Sanctuary (July-September 2020)
Prophecy (October-December 2020)
Dreams (January-March 2021)
Assembly (April-June 2021)
The Little Prince (July-September 2021)
Flight (October-December 2021)
Abyss (January-March 2022)
Performance (April-June 2022)
Shattering (July- current)

I went thru my folder with old hockey magazines I had saved from around 2011 to 2015 and came across this one and thought it could be a fun to make a post about now in hindsight.
This is Jääkiekko magazine from May 2012, they always have a section of "99 questions with ..." and in this issue they interviewed Teräväinen.
I’ve translated the questions I found interesting under the cut! It ended up being about half of the interview. (*) are my additions.
On the cover "seuraava superjokeri" means the next super joker, he played for Helsingin Jokerit so it's a word play from that. Under, on the blue print it says: "The 17-year-old forward will become a first round draft pick in the summer. The natural goal scorer can dominate in SM-Liiga as soon as next season."
In the 2nd photo the headline and lead paragraph goes:
"A post with dents* - A year ago Teuvo Teräväinen was known only within a small number of hockey insiders. Few passers-by recognize him now either but after a flashy rookie season the Jokerit sensation is on the radar of every NHL team and is a strong contender to become a first round draft pick. Next season with Jokerit the talented second line center will be one of the main talking points in the SM-Liiga."
(*references the net Teräväinen had in his backyard and into which he practiced his shooting)
